Made it myself with friends :biggrin:
JL 8w0 in each access door, sealed the upper half of the door from the lower half to make an enclosure, 3layers of Dynamat (2 on outside skin and 1 on inside)
ef015bc9.jpg

ef015bb7.jpg

2 Zapco Competition 5 1\4 mids and Zapco Competition tweeter in each front door with 2layer Dynamat (1 outside and 1 inside)
ef015bae.jpg


thats pretty much it ! i went for lots of mids, midbass and SQ !
